How Can Carding Machines Save Energy and Reduce Costs?

How Can Carding Machines Save Energy and Reduce Costs?

Introduction:
Carding machines are used in the textile industry to prepare fibers for spinning. They play a crucial role in the manufacturing process and consume a significant amount of energy. This article discusses how carding machines can save energy and reduce costs.


Carding Machine

Reduce Machine Idle Time:
Carding machines consume energy when they are running, but they also consume energy when they are idle. Idle time usually happens when the machine is waiting for the next batch of fibers. By reducing idle time, manufacturers can save energy and reduce costs.

One way to reduce machine idle time is by optimizing the processing speed of the machine. Manufacturers can also schedule batches of fibers to minimize downtime.

Efficient Use of Motors:
A Carding Machine has various motors that consume energy. Efficient use of these motors can help save energy and reduce costs. One way to achieve efficient use of motors is by choosing energy-efficient motors. Energy-efficient motors consume less energy for the same level of performance as standard motors.

Another way to save energy is by ensuring motors are adequately sized for their intended use. An oversized motor usually consumes more energy than necessary. Also, proper maintenance of motors, such as lubrication and alignment, ensures they operate efficiently.

Use of Energy-Efficient Lighting:
Carding machines usually operate in a factory setting, and lighting is necessary for operation. The use of energy-efficient lighting can help reduce energy consumption and costs. LED lights are an excellent choice for factories as they consume less energy and have longer lifespans than conventional lighting.

Monitor and Manage Energy Usage:
Real-time energy monitoring and management systems can help manufacturers track their energy consumption and identify areas of high energy use. This information can be used to optimize operations and reduce energy consumption.

Implementing Smart Power Management Systems:
Smart power management systems can help reduce energy consumption in carding machines. These systems monitor power usage and adjust it according to the machine's needs. For example, during periods of low operation or idle time, the system can reduce power consumption to save energy.

Conclusion:
Carding machines are crucial in the textile industry, but they consume a significant amount of energy. Implementing energy-saving techniques, such as reducing idle time, efficient use of motors, using energy-efficient lighting, monitoring energy usage, and implementing smart power management systems, can help manufacturers save energy and reduce costs.
